Exploring the Sacred Maya Devi Temple in Haridwar

Nestled amidst the spiritual aura of Haridwar, the Maya Devi Temple stands as a testament to devotion and ancient heritage. Dedicated to the Hindu goddess Maya Devi, this revered shrine holds immense significance for pilgrims and tourists alike. Believed to be one of the Siddha Peethas, the Maya Devi Temple has a rich history dating back to ancient times. Legend has it that the heart and navel of the goddess Sati, wife of Lord Shiva, fell at this sacred spot during the divine dance of destruction, known as Tandava. Over the centuries, the temple has undergone numerous renovations and expansions, yet it has retained its spiritual essence.

Architecture and Design:

The architectural style of the Maya Devi Temple reflects a blend of traditional North Indian temple architecture with intricate carvings and embellishments. The sanctum sanctorum houses the deity of Maya Devi adorned with exquisite ornaments and offerings. The temple complex also features other shrines dedicated to various Hindu deities, adding to its architectural splendour.

Religious Significance:

Devotees flock to the Maya Devi Temple seeking blessings for fertility, prosperity, and protection from evil forces. It is believed that offering prayers and performing rituals at this sacred site fulfils one's desires and brings spiritual enlightenment. The temple is particularly revered by couples seeking blessings for marital harmony and childbirth.

Rituals and Festivals:

The Maya Devi Temple witnesses a constant stream of devotees participating in various rituals and ceremonies throughout the year. Special pujas, aartis, and homes are conducted regularly, invoking the divine presence of the goddess. The Navratri festival holds special significance at the temple, attracting devotees from far and wide to celebrate the triumph of good over evil.

Time to Visit 06:00 AM to 12:00 PM & 04:00 PM to 08:00 PM
Entry Fees Free

How to reach Maya Devi Temple, Haridwar?

To reach Maya Devi Temple in Haridwar, you can:
By Road: Hire a taxi or take a local bus to Haridwar and then walk to the temple located near the Har Ki Pauri.
By Train: Disembark at Haridwar Junction Railway Station and take a short auto-rickshaw or taxi ride to the temple.
By Air: Land at Dehradun's Jolly Grant Airport, then hire a taxi or take a bus to Haridwar, followed by a short walk to the temple precincts.
